Until recently, I believe it had been several years since I had ventured out to Jazzin’ at the Shedd and I wondered how it may have changed. When I heard that Detour JazFunk was opening this year’s season, I knew I had to be there!
Detour was outstanding, as per their usual. Comprised of Phil Seed (Guitar and Lead Vocals), Kenery Kent Smith (Bass Guitar), Ben “Jammin’” Johnson (Drums & Lead/Background Vocals) and a keyboardist who most often seems to be Tim Gant, Detour is cohesive and smoking’!!! They performed a perfect mix of jazz, R&B and neo-soul! Joined by Carla Prather and Elena Love [check], the music was HOT! A better opening act couldn’t have been chosen.
